Abstract

Composting is one of the many methods of processing organic waste that aims to reduce and change the composition of waste into more useful fertilizer. This article attempts to provide an overview and explanation of the work program for making compost fertilizer, including the process, stages, results and benefits. This article was written using a qualitative approach with a descriptive-explanatory model. As a result, the community gained new understanding and insights about the use of household organic waste. In addition, people can reduce the use of chemical fertilizers and factory-made fertilizers, which are generally used by village communities, thereby reducing expenses in the agricultural process. This article is limited to the implementation of regular KKN 114 at UIN Sunan Kalijaga Yogyakarta 2024. This article also contributes to the implementation strategy of the SDGs points.
